以蟒蛇的方式控制基于scpi的仪器的软件包。

RSSscpi的Python项目详细描述


这个python库的目的是提供一种编写测量仪器远程控制程序的好方法 在Python中。这主要是通过将所有scpi命令转换为等效的python类来实现的,这样就没有文本字符串了 对于scpi命令必须由程序员输入。这将有望减少代码中的错误,并增加 程序员的生产力。

主要功能

  • 完整的SCPI命令类继承;从提取的命令列表自动生成
  • 每个scpi命令类都有一个docstring,其中包含指向相关联机手册页的链接
  • py.test回归测试套件
  • helper类包装更公开的scpi命令

要使用这个库,您需要pyvisa和合适的visa后端。

有关鼓舞人心的用法,请参见examples/

请向lukas.sandstrom@rohde-schwarz.comhttps://github.com/luksan/RSSscpi报告错误

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
带Maven的Eclipse Java存储库:缺少工件:compile   java如何以编程方式停止RMI服务器并通知所有客户端   java Roboguice抛出ClassNotFoundException:AnnotationDatabaseImpl   java为什么lucene 4.0删除IndexWriter类的两个构造函数?   nls如何避免java项目上不需要的日志消息?   测试无法在Selenium Webdriver(java)中定位iframe   使用XML的java servlet   java如何使用jxl用****屏蔽单元格   java使用SQLite从数据库中选择“没有这样的列”   导入扫描程序后出现java编译错误   插入查询的java空指针异常   使用创建PostgreSQL数据库。Java应用中的sql脚本   java使用jsoup将HTML解析为格式化的明文